Description
This most elegant-looking example of Jaguar's immortal MKII Saloon is finished in a stately shade of Dark Blue and trimmed in Red hide, and rides on chrome wire wheels. Its 3.4 litre XK engine is paired with automatic transmission and the odometer currently reads a totally credible (though unwarranted) 89,000 miles. 'AGV 169B' has been in its current ownership since May 2012 and recent maintenance has involved new front tyres, suspension bushes, gearbox and engine mounts, carpets, door cards, arm rests, pockets and seat squabs. Desirable upgrades to the standard specification include electric fan, electronic ignition and a stainless steel exhaust system. The vendor confirms the Jaguar 'drives well with good oil pressure' and is now offering it complete with a collection of invoices. A road test of a 3.4-litre model conducted by Motor magazine in 1961 resulted in a commendable 0-60mph time of 11.9 seconds and a top speed of a whisker under 120mph.
